Simon Philip Cowell (born 1959-10-07 in Brighton, England) is a British A & R (artist and repertoire) executive for BMG Records. He is probably best known as a judge on the television programs The X-Factor and American Idol.

  • Very simple. I'm putting up the money, and I also have ears.
    • On Americans who question his right to judge Americans since he is British
    • Quoted in Bill Keveney, "Viewers 'Idol'-ize this saucy search for a superstar," USA Today (2002-06-18)
  • You know Paula, who I couldn't look at the beginning of the series... I love her to death now. I hate to admit it but I do.
    • Quoted on Entertainment Tonight (2003-05-21)
  • Sinitta and Jackie are my family now. I don't think of them as ex-girlfriends anymore. They are an extension of my life... It must be infuriating, but I'd never change because my ex-girlfriends are so close I couldn't imagine life without them.
    • Quoted in mirror.co.uk interview (2005-10-22)
  • Normally, they want me to be rude to them. People come up to me and sing, and I say "That was great. Thank you." And they're like "Well, aren't you going to be rude to me?" No! When I miss auditions, contestants get upset that I'm not there, because they expect me to be cruel to them — it's some sort of badge of honor. That's how crazy everything is.
    • Quoted in interview, Playboy magazine (February 2007)
  • If I tape an 11-hour day, guess which parts end up on air. Not the bits when I'm pleasant, but the parts when I'm obnoxious.
    • Quoted in interview, Playboy magazine (February 2007)
